The CIM Professional Diploma in Marketing at Southampton Solent University is aimed at professionals with a background in marketing operations, brand management, account management or other functional management and 2-3 years work experience who aspire to, or are just entering, marketing management positions.
The CIM Professional Diploma is a stretching and challenging course which allows you to develop the marketing management skills sought after in both the private and public sectors. Candidates will be taught the important skills of creative thinking, communicating effectively, planning, prioritising, evaluating risk, running projects and evaluating decisions in a marketing environment.
The Professional Diploma is particularly suitable for people wishing to build on a marketing career and who are looking to move into management roles. The qualification will also give you access to the world's leading professional marketing organisation. The courses cover a range of relevant business topics, in addition to marketing and sales.
On obtaining the Professional Diploma, which is a Degree level qualification, you may progress immediately to marketing courses at postgraduate level (eg CIM Professional Postgraduate Diploma in Marketing or our MA Marketing Management).
Our students are taught by specialist marketing academics who have practical experience in industry, commerce, services and non-profit sectors.
Southampton Solent University has an excellent track record of running the previous Diploma for many years and has a pass rate which is above the national average. Students also benefit from a University atmosphere and access to all of our resources, including one of the best sets of books and on-line marketing resources in the south.
Course structure
Period 1 September - January (March assessment)
Managing Marketing
This unit aims to help students develop a practical approach to manage human and financial resources. It focuses on the marketer as a manager and tests candidates ability to apply their skills in a practical way.
Assessment: 6,000 word work based assignment
Delivering Customer Value through Marketing
The focus of this unit is on helping businesses manage their offering to their markets through reasoned control of such factors as brands, pricing, distribution channels, service and communications. Students will have to prepare a business case based on a case study. Familiarity with the other three units is assumed.
Assessment: 3 hour exam based on pre-issued case study.
Period 2 January - May (June assessment)
Marketing Planning Process
Students will learn about, and be able to carry out, the preparation of a marketing plan in the context of a thought through understanding of the environment the firm is operating in and the impact of these planning decisions on the business.
Assessment: 6,000 word work based assignment.
Project Management in Marketing
This unit will give students the skills to successfully design, promote and manage successful marketing projects through the application of information, development of cost and risk assessed business cases and the use of project management tools.
Assessment: 6,000 word work based assignment.
|Assessment
In order to sit the appropriate assessment, all students must register as Studying Members with the CIM (enclosing the appropriate fee) and are themselves responsible for ensuring that registration is completed satisfactorily. CIM membership fees are currently tax deductible.
In addition, students are responsible for correctly entering the appropriate assessment with the CIM (again enclosing the appropriate fee).
Attendance
The Professional Diploma qualification can be taken entirely within one Academic Year or spread over two. This is to allow flexibility for students to be able to manage their work/life balance effectively to suit their individual circumstances.
One-year programme:
Normally on Tuesdays 2pm-9pm throughout the Academic Year, studying four subjects during the year. If there is sufficient demand we will offer the course two evenings per week to enable students who cannot obtain half day release to still complete the programme in one year.
Two-year Programme:
Normally on Tuesday evenings, studying two subjects per year.
Fees
Fees for the academic year 2013/14 are:
£320 per unit for UK and EU students
